Snowflake's Cloud Platform: A Game-Changer For Big Data Analytics

The blog outlines Snowflake: Revolutionizing Data Management in the Cloud
  • Snowflake's Cloud Platform
  • Key features of Snowflake include:
  • Architecture of Snowflake:
  • Snowflake's architecture also includes a number of other key components, including:
  • Benefits of snowflake
coverImg

Snowflake's Cloud Platform

Snowflake is a cloud-based data platform that provides a range of features and capabilities for managing and analysing data. The platform is designed to be highly scalable and flexible, allowing organizations to store and process data from a wide range of sources. One of the key benefits of Snowflake is its ability to provide a single location for storing and analysing data, making it easier for organizations to gain insights and make data-driven decisions.

Key features of Snowflake include:

Cloud-based: Snowflake is a fully cloud-based platform that allows users to access data from anywhere with an internet connection. Snowflake is a cloud-based data warehousing and analytics platform that is designed to run entirely in the cloud. The platform is built on top of public cloud infrastructure providers such as Amazon Web Services (AWS) and Microsoft Azure, allowing organizations to store, process, and analyse data in a fully-managed cloud environment. One of the key benefits of Snowflake being cloud-based is its scalability. The platform is designed to handle large amounts of data, and can easily scale up or down to meet the needs of organizations. This means that organizations can start small and grow as needed, without having to worry about the underlying infrastructure.

Data Warehousing: Snowflake provides a highly scalable data warehousing solution that can store and process large amounts of data. Data warehousing is a key feature of Snowflake's cloud platform. The platform offers a fully-managed solution or data warehousing, allowing organizations to store and analyse large amounts of data with ease. One of the key benefits of data warehousing in Snowflake is its ability to handle large amounts of data. The platform is designed to be highly scalable, allowing organizations to store and process petabytes of data with ease. This makes it an attractive option for organizations that need to store and analyse large amounts of data on a regular basis.

Data Sharing: Snowflake allows organizations to securely share data with other users, departments, or even external partners. Data sharing is a key feature of Snowflake's cloud platform that allows organizations to securely share data with other Snowflake users, both within and outside of their organization. This feature enables organizations to collaborate more effectively and efficiently by sharing data in real-time. One of the key benefits of data sharing in Snowflake is that it is secure. The platform uses advanced security features such as encryption and access controls to ensure that data is only accessible to authorized users. This means that organizations can share data with confidence, knowing that it is protected from unauthorized access.

Performance: Snowflake's cloud platform is designed to provide high-performance data warehousing and analytics capabilities. The platform is optimized for both storage and compute, allowing it to handle large amounts of data with ease One of the key factors that contribute to Snowflake's performance is its architecture. The platform is designed to be highly scalable, allowing it to handle large workloads and high concurrency.

Security: Snowflake's cloud platform is designed with security in mind and includes a range of advanced security features to protect data and ensure compliance with industry standards.'One of the key security features of Snowflake is encryption. All data stored in Snowflake is encrypted using strong, industry-standard encryption algorithms. This includes data at rest and in transit, ensuring that data is always protected. Snowflake also provides encryption key management, allowing customers to manage their own encryption keys or use keys managed by Snowflake.

Integrations: Snowflake integrates with a wide range of third-party tools and platforms, including popular business intelligence and data visualization tools.

Architecture of Snowflake:

The architecture of Snowflake is designed to provide a highly scalable, cloud-based platform for data warehousing and analytics. The platform is built on top of Amazon Web Services (AWS) and Microsoft Azure, leveraging their infrastructure to provide a fully-managed solution for storing, processing, and analysing data.

At the core of Snowflake's architecture is a separation of storage and compute. Data is stored in a centralized data repository, while compute resources are provisioned on an as-needed basis. This allows organizations to scale their compute resources up or down as needed, without having to worry about the underlying infrastructure.

Snowflake's architecture also includes a number of other key components, including:

Database:Snowflake's database is a distributed, shared-nothing architecture that allows for high scalability and performance. The database is designed to handle large amounts of data, and can store both structured and semi-structured data.

Compute: Snowflake's compute resources are provisioned on an as-needed basis, allowing organizations to scale up or down as needed. This provides flexibility and helps to reduce costs.

Services: Snowflake includes a number of services that help to manage and optimize the platform, including security, metadata management, and query optimization.

Virtual Warehouse: Snowflake's virtual warehouse allows users to create separate compute clusters for different workloads. This provides greater control over compute resources and allows for more efficient use of resources.

Cloud Storage: Snowflake leverages cloud storage providers such as Amazon S3 and Microsoft Azure Blob Storage to provide a highly scalable, durable solution for storing data.

Benefits of snowflake

Snowflake is a cloud-based data platform that offers a range of benefits for organizations looking to manage and analyse large amounts of data. One of the key benefits of Snowflake is its ability to provide a fully-managed, scalable solution for data warehousing, allowing organizations to store and process large amounts of data with ease. This makes it easier to access and analyse data from a variety of sources, leading to more informed decision-making.

Ready to
work together

Ready to embark on a collaborative journey with us? At Basal, we're enthusiastic about working together to tackle challenges and achieve mutual success. Let's combine our expertise, share ideas, and drive results. Contact us today to begin this exciting partnership!

Request Types *